1.    What is the standard height and width of a football goal? 2.    How many holes are there in a bowling ball used in a game of tenpin bowling? 3.    There are five rings in the Olympic flag, representing the five main continents of the world, what are the colours of these rings? 4.    The game of baseball was invented in which country? 5.    How many players are there in a rugby league team? 6.    What is the name of the racquet game played in a closed wall court with a small rubber ball? 7.    How many bases must be completed/passed in a game of rounders to score a point? 8.    What is the name of throwing stick used by Aborigines in Australia that can return to its thrower? 9.    In which sport might you do a slam dunk? 10.    Which flag is waved in motor racing to show the winner of a race? — Rehan Jalal

Answers:

1.    Football goal measurements should be: Height 2.4m and width 7.3m

2.    Three (3)

3.    Red, yellow, green, blue and black

4.    England

5.    Thirteen (13)

6.    Squash

7.    Four (4)

8.    Boomerang

9.    Basketball

10.    A black and white chequered flag
